在数字化时代,网络攻击成为企业面临的一大挑战。其中,分布式拒绝服务(DDoS)攻击因其破坏性、隐蔽性和难以防范的特性,成为企业网络安全的头号威胁。本文将深入解析企业DDoS攻击防护的成本,并提供实战攻略,帮助企业筑牢网络安全防线。
成本解析
1. 直接成本
a. 防护设备投资
为了有效抵御DDoS攻击,企业需要投入相应的防护设备,如防火墙、入侵检测系统(IDS)等。这些设备的成本往往较高,特别是针对大型企业。
# 示例:计算防火墙设备成本
def calculate_firewall_cost(size):
price_per_gbps = 1000 # 每Gbps的价格
return price_per_gbps * size # 总价格
# 假设企业需要的防火墙容量为10Gbps
firewall_cost = calculate_firewall_cost(10)
print("防火墙设备成本:", firewall_cost, "元")
b. 人工成本
企业需要配备专业的网络安全人员负责DDoS防护工作,包括设备维护、数据监控和应急处理等。这直接增加了企业的人力成本。
c. 应急处理费用
当DDoS攻击发生时,企业需要启动应急预案,可能涉及外部专家咨询、带宽扩容等,这些都会产生额外的费用。
2. 间接成本
a. 业务中断损失
DDoS攻击会导致企业网站或系统无法访问,进而影响业务运营,造成潜在的经济损失。
# 示例:计算业务中断损失
def calculate_business_loss(downtime_hours, loss_per_hour):
return downtime_hours * loss_per_hour
# 假设DDoS攻击导致业务中断10小时,每小时损失1000元
business_loss = calculate_business_loss(10, 1000)
print("业务中断损失:", business_loss, "元")
b. 品牌形象受损
频繁的DDoS攻击事件会损害企业品牌形象,影响客户信任度,从而间接影响企业长期发展。
实战攻略
1. 建立完善的DDoS防护体系
a. 预防策略
- 对内部网络进行安全审计,消除潜在的安全漏洞;
- 实施访问控制策略,限制外部访问;
- 采用WAF(Web应用防火墙)等技术,提高Web应用的安全性。
b. 检测与响应
- 使用入侵检测系统(IDS)和入侵防御系统(IPS)等设备实时监测网络流量,及时发现异常;
- 建立应急预案,确保在攻击发生时能够迅速响应。
2. 利用云服务
a. 云DDoS防护
将DDoS防护任务交给云服务提供商,可以降低企业自身的投资成本,同时享受更专业的防护服务。
# 示例:计算云DDoS防护成本
def calculate_cloud_ddos_protection_cost(transferred_data, price_per_gb):
return transferred_data * price_per_gb
# 假设企业每月需要处理10TB的流量,每GB的价格为0.1元
cloud_ddos_cost = calculate_cloud_ddos_protection_cost(10 * 1024, 0.1)
print("云DDoS防护成本:", cloud_ddos_cost, "元")
b. 云备份与容灾
通过云服务进行数据备份和容灾,可以在攻击发生时迅速恢复业务,降低损失。
3. 提高员工安全意识
定期开展网络安全培训,提高员工对DDoS攻击的认识,培养良好的安全操作习惯,从源头上降低安全风险。
总之,企业DDoS攻击防护是一项系统工程,需要企业综合考虑成本与效益,采取科学、合理的防护措施,才能有效应对日益严峻的网络威胁。
